304/304L Stainless Steel Round, an economical grade of stainless that is ideal for all applications where strength and superior corrosion resistance is required. 304 Stainless Round has a durable dull, mill finish that is widely used for all types of fabrication projects that are exposed to the elements – chemical, acidic, fresh water, and salt water environments.
Specifications: ASTM A276, QQS-763, T304/304L,non-polished finish
AKA: stainless rod, stainless round bar
Applications: frame work, braces, supports, shafting. axels, marine, food, etc.
Workability: Easy to Weld, Moderate Cutting, Forming and Machining.
Mechanical Properties: Brinell = 170, Tensile = 85,000 +/-, Yield = 34,000 +/-
Nonmagnetic
How is it Measured? Diameter (A) X Length

Type 316 (UNS S31600) is a molybdenum-bearing austenitic stainless steel which is more resistant to general
corrosion and pitting/crevice corrosion than the conventional chromium-nickel austenitic stainless steels
such as Type 304. This alloy also offers higher creep, stress-to-rupture and tensile strength at elevated
temperatures. In addition to excellent corrosion resistance and strength properties, grades 316 and 316L also
provide the excellent fabricability and formability which are typical of austenitic stainless steels

- Stainless Steel Alloy 431 is a martensitic, heat-treatable grade with excellent corrosion resistance, torque strength, high toughness and tensile properties. These properties make grade 431 ideal for bolt and shaft applications but the grade cannot be cold-worked owing to its high yield strength. Subsequently, the grade is suitable for operations such as spinning, deep drawing, bending or cold heading.
- Martensitic steels fabrication is typically conducted using techniques that allow hardening and tempering treatments and poor weldability. The corrosion resistance properties of 431 steels are lower than that of austenitic grades. The operations of grade 431 are limited by their loss of strength at high temperatures, due to over-tempering, and loss of ductility at negative temperature
